The Brief

At DDM School the central courtyard functions as the heart of campus life—a space of gathering, movement, and shared moments for hundreds of students each day. ISTAKA transformed this large pedestrian zone into a structured yet playful ground plane using modular pavers that could withstand high footfall while maintaining visual identity. The result is a courtyard that organizes movement, encourages interaction, and becomes an integral part of the school’s daily rhythm.

Design Approach

The design introduces a strong geometric language through a zigzag composition using Brikweave pavers at the core, creating visual movement across the courtyard. Quadra pavers define the outer edges, absorbing irregularities caused by existing trees while maintaining a clean modular system. Stonske elements were extended around tree bases to act as minimalist guards, integrating landscape elements seamlessly with the paving grid. The final composition balances structure and spontaneity—allowing the courtyard to feel energetic without visual clutter.

Products & Applications

Brikweave – Central courtyard areas with uniform sizing for visual consistency. Stonske – Bordering elements and tree guards for clean edge definition. Quadra – Edge unification, absorbing layout irregularities gracefully.
